Thanks guys. And yes Daryl. It was the 160 grain Sierra Round Nose bullet I killed the buck with last year. The doe was killed with the 156 grain PPU. The PPU is even more accurate then the Sierra, and I never thought I'd say that. My friend Randy has a 260 Rem which also shoots the Sierra super well. But they quit making them, so we have to try others and the Hornady seems good and from kills I have seen shot from the 260 and the 6.5 Swede, it's pretty good on game, but in my rifles and in Randy's rifle the Sierra was better. Now I am VERY pleased with the PPU 156 grain, but one kill with a neck shot is not a very "in-depth" test. So far so good however. |
